RGGI, Inc. Staff

Jonathan Schrag, Executive Director

Jonathan Schrag is the Executive Director of RGGI, Inc. Before RGGI, Jonathan was a partner of Hudson Strategic Energy Advisors LLC, where he worked with the state governments of Wyoming, West Virginia, and Montana and the Western Governors Association on energy, climate and the environment.

From 2005 to 2007, Jonathan was an Assistant Director of the Earth Institute at Columbia University and the Executive Director of the Lenfest Center for Sustainable Energy, where he ran policy research programs on carbon capture and sequestration, nuclear energy, carbon policy, and renewable energy technologies. Jonathan also served as Research Staff with the Global Roundtable on Climate Change and as a Research Associate for Columbia University’s Center for Carbon Management.

Jonathan currently serves as a member of the Energy and Environmental markets Committee of the U.S Commodity Futures Trading Commission and as a member of the Advisory Board of the New York City Accelerator for a Clean and Renewable Economy.

Jonathan graduated from Harvard University and received a Fulbright scholarship for research in the history of electrification. He lives in New York City.

 

Laura Thomas, Business Manager

 

Laura joined RGGI, Inc. as Business Manager in December 2008. Before joining RGGI, Laura was a Vice President and Business Manager in Merrill Lynch's Global Markets and Investment Banking Division.

From 2000 to 2006, Laura was an Assistant Vice President in the Mergers & Acquisitions Group at Credit Suisse where she served as the group's financial operating officer.  From 1995 through 2000, Laura was a Junior Analyst and then a Research Associate at Donaldson, Lufkin & Jenrette.

Laura graduated from San Francisco State University with a B.A in Sociology. She has recently completed her Masters Certificate in Finance at Baruch CAPS.

Nicole Singh, Auction Program Manager

 

Nicole joined RGGI, Inc. as Auction Program Manager in January 2009. Prior to her current position, Nicole was the Associate Director for the Environmental Bankers Association (EBA) and a Senior Associate for Risk Management Technologies, Inc (RTMI).

For over five years, Nicole helped manage all aspects of the EBA, a non-profit trade association that represents the financial services industry and those who provide services to them. Nicole worked to promote environmentally sound lending and fiduciary activities and new concepts of social responsibility for the financial services sector. She served as the in house expert on environmental, social, governance (ESG) issues. For RTMI, Nicole performed environmental consulting for private sector and government clients.

Nicole has also worked for and performed research for the United Nations High Commissioner for Refugees, World Wildlife Fund-Tanzania Program Office and Defenders of Wildlife.

Nicole received her M.P.A. from Princeton University and her B.A. from Franklin & Marshall College. 

 

Paul Ghosh-Roy, Offsets Program Manager

 

Paul joined RGGI, Inc. as Offsets Program Manager in September 2009.  Prior to his current position, Paul was an associate in the project finance group at the law firm of Latham & Watkins.  At Latham, Paul's practice focused on transactions in the energy industry for clients ranging from renewable energy project developers to financial lending institutions.  Paul was also a member of the firm's climate change practice group.

Before joining Latham & Watkins, Paul was a law clerk to two federal administrative law judges at the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ission (FERC) in Washington, D.C. At FERC, Paul researched and drafted decisions, orders and settlement certifications in connection with various energy regulatory issues.

Paul's experience also includes an internship with the United States Department of Justice, Environmental Enforcement Section.  He received his J.D., cum laude, from American University's Washington College of Law and his B.A. from Georgetown University.

 

 

Emilee Pierce, Communications Manager

Emilee is Communications Manager at RGGI, Inc. Prior to RGGI, she was Account Manager at Futerra Sustainability Communications, where she created and executed strategic environmental communications campaigns for government, non-profit and corporate clients, including RGGI, Inc., Time Warner and JP Morgan Climate Care.

From 2006 - 2008 Emilee worked as Associate at Morrissey & Company Public Relations and Reputation Management. At Morrissey & Company, she provided media and analyst relations, internal communications and crisis communications services to clients in health care, technology, insurance and non-profit industries. In 2005, she was Assistant to the Communications Director of Joseph P. Kennedy II's Citizens Energy Corporation.

Emilee holds a B.S. in Communications magna cum laude from Boston University. She joined RGGI, Inc. as Communications Manager in February 2009.

Lisa DeVito, Program Coordinator

Lisa is Program Coordinator at RGGI, Inc. Prior to RGGI, Lisa was Press Aide and Special Assistant to the President of the New Jersey Board of Public Utilities (BPU). At BPU Lisa implemented digital marketing strategies for New Jersey's Clean Energy Program and provided research, operations and communications support to the President. Lisa's experience also includes positions at U.S. Senator Bob Menendez's DC Office, the Communications Office of New Jersey's BPU, and the New Jersey Department of Personnel.

Lisa received her B.A. in Political Science and Anthropology from the University of Michigan.
